Re: Citizenship pink IC collection

](*,)

You are supposed to arrange for collection of your IC (and passport) yourself from the post office via the SingPass app within, I think, the first month of completing formalities and swearing the oath of allegiance. The only thing you will get at the citizenship ceremony is your Certificate of Citizenship.

I collected my IC and passport (you have to apply for each separately) from the post office less than a week after I competed the formalities.

I strongly advise that you call ICA immediately (their contact details are at the bottom of the ICA website) and explain your situation. Ask them you talk you through the next steps. I am not sure that your temporary IC slip is even valid any more.

You need to settle this straight away.
